Which division of the peripheral nervous system carries messages from sense organs and internal organs to the central nervous system?

1 Answer

0 votes
by (670 points)

sensory division

All other nervous tissue in the body makes up the peripheral nervous system, which has two major divisions. The sensory division carries messages from sense organs and internal organs to the central nervous system. The motor division carries messages from the central nervous system to muscles, internal organs, and glands throughout the body. The motor division is further divided into parts that control involuntary or voluntary responses.
